Piece by Piece: A Libraries Community Textile Art Project for Family History Month

This project invites people of all ages to reflect on their own family history and contribute a small creative textile piece that reflects their whakapapa, treasured memories, heritage, traditions, and connections. All shapes and sizes are accepted, though the maximum size is 20cm square (plus allowance for joining together). Simple or intricate, every piece and every story matters.

Use sewing, fabric, raranga, collage, embroidery, quilting, weaving, crochet, appliqué, dyes, drawing, image transfer, natural and repurposed materials, or any other textile-inspired techniques. Once collected, these smaller pieces will be assembled together, and the final community artwork will be displayed at the library.

3 ways to participate:

  • Begin your contribution during a Stoke Library workshop on 12 August.
  • Take home a materials pack (available for a limited time) and work at your own pace.
  • Use your own meaningful ideas and materials and work from home.

Drop your finished piece into any of the library branches with an optional accompanying info sheet (provided) by Wednesday, 30 September.

Kindly supported by Textile ResQ.
